Failure to Maintain Safe Food Storage Temperatures in Medication Room Refrigerators
E
F0812 F812: Procure food from sources approved or considered satisfactory and store, prepare, distribute and serve food in accordance with professional standards.
Short Summary

Surveyors found that food stored in medication room refrigerators was repeatedly kept above the facility's required temperature range, with logs showing multiple days of elevated readings and missed documentation. Staff demonstrated inconsistent understanding of proper temperature ranges, and the temperature log did not clearly distinguish between food and medication storage requirements. No evidence was found that maintenance was notified or corrective action taken during the period, resulting in noncompliance with food safety standards.

Unclean Tube Feeding Equipment Due to Unclear Cleaning Responsibilities
D
F0584 F584: Honor the resident's right to a safe, clean, comfortable and homelike environment, including but not limited to receiving treatment and supports for daily living safely.
Short Summary

A resident's tube feeding pole and related equipment were repeatedly observed to be covered in dried feeding splatter and debris over several days. Interviews with LPNs, housekeeping, and the DON revealed confusion about who was responsible for cleaning the equipment, resulting in ongoing unsanitary conditions.

Failure to Maintain Infection Control During Bowel and Bladder Care
D
F0880 F880: Provide and implement an infection prevention and control program.
Short Summary

Staff failed to follow infection prevention and control protocols during bowel and bladder care for a resident with hemiplegia and a gastrostomy tube. Observations included a resident sitting on feeding tube tubing, staff reconnecting tubing without changing it, use of dirty gloves during peri care, and providing a washcloth that had fallen on the floor for personal hygiene. These actions occurred despite the resident requiring assistance and being cognitively intact.
